Despite Real Madrid top brass being on the move to try signing Argentinian international striker Mauro Icardi (24), and possibly available to pay the 110 million euros exit clause set on him, Inter Milan management, according to Tuttosport, are not in fear to lose their hitman and captain. Neroazzurri board are in fact confident the player will be soon accepting to have his contract with them extended.
